Mandarin classes are a new battleground between China and Taiwan

Por: Los Angeles Times Nation May 05, 2023

thumbnail

In the relaxed cadences of her native Taiwan, Kelly Chuang instructed her students to repeat after her. “Wo bu shi taiwan ren. Wo shi meiguo ren” — “I’m not Taiwanese. I’m American.” She projected the written Chinese for the phrases onto a white board. “Taiwan” appeared in the traditional form, with 25 strokes in the second character alone.
